The white wine Grüner Veltliner Weinviertel DAC Altes Gebirge, vintage 2021 from the winery Weingut Lachinger has been rated in 2022 by Peter Moser with 90 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Grüner Veltliner from the region Weinviertel in Austria.

Tasting Notes

90
Tasting from 05.08.2022: Peter Moser

Pale yellow-green, silver reflections. Delicate notes of fresh orange zest, a hint of Golden Delicious apple, tobacco nuances, some meadow herbs. Lean, white fruit, lemony core, mineral-salty finish.
